Position

Program Coordinator

General Purpose

Under the supervision of the Club Leader, the Program Coordinator is responsible for overseeing and operating programming within a specific club. Works directly with groups of up to 20 members, following the school day.

Essential Duties & Responsibilities
  • Implements daily challenges and learning activities on a daily basis.
  • Executes targeted enrichment programs that support English Language Learners, positive relationship building, problem‑solving, and social‑emotional development.
  • Delivers programs and activities in the following five core areas:
    Academic Success, The Arts, Leadership & Service, Sports, and Health & Wellness.
  • Establishes a strong relationship with school teachers.
Fosters Strong Relationships With Members Through
  • Role modeling and group management.
  • Creating an environment that facilitates achievement.
  • Maintaining enthusiasm and a positive attitude with youth and within the club community.
  • Conveying warmth, care & proper guidance in ongoing interactions with members.
  • Consistent attendance to create stability for club members.
  • Maintains a safe, clean, appealing environment and ensures member safety through proper supervision.
  • Utilizes trauma‑informed behavior management tools to ensure the safety and enjoyment of all members.
  • Actively participates in daily and weekly club communication with co‑workers, supervisors, volunteers and parents regarding member behavior and achievements.
  • Encourages members to take responsibility for their good behavior and reinforces high behavior expectations at all times.
